Paozi is a basic Chinese character in China, and its meaning and form have rich cultural connotation and historical background. From the glyph, the word "cannon" consists of "fire" and "bag", which shows that its original meaning is related to fire and bag. In ancient times, people used the word "cannon" to represent the ammunition package detonated by gunpowder, so the original meaning of the word "cannon" was related to gunpowder and war.
With the development of Chinese characters, the meaning of "cannon" has gradually expanded to other aspects, such as baking and frying in cooking, as well as various electromagnetic cannons and laser cannons in modern science and technology. Secondly, the word "cannon" contains rich cultural connotations. In ancient China, the word "cannon" was one of the indispensable weapons in the war. Therefore, the word "cannon" also symbolizes war and courage. In ancient poetry.
You can often see poems that describe war scenes with "guns", such as "guns rumbling" and "guns blazing". In addition, the word "cannon" can also represent a cooking method, that is, the food is roasted and fried to golden brown at high temperature, which is very common in China cuisine. Therefore, the word "cannon" is also related to food culture. Finally, the writing of the word "cannon" also has unique artistic value.
In brush calligraphy, we should pay attention to the shape beside the word "fire" and the thickness and radian of the strokes, and the overall shape should be beautiful and generous. In hard-pen calligraphy, the writing of the word "cannon" should pay attention to the simplicity and clarity of the font to avoid being too complicated.
